My friend ask me about holiday pay. 14,000 po monthly rate nya pero may factor po na 23.75 days para macompute daily rate nya. Bayad daw po sya ng one Saturday per cut off at hindi bayad sa ibang Saturday at lahat ng Sundays. Is he a monhtly paid employee? And if pumatak ng Sunday or Saturday yung holiday entitled po ba sya for a holiday pay?

This is the rule: when you are a monthly paid employee, the holiday pay is already included in the monthly pay. Ang holiday pay ay usually ina-apply sa daily wage earner (may nakalagay sa employment contract na daily rate or hourly rate tapos, mayroong limit ng number of hours per day).
Hindi mo kasi sinabi kung ito ay dito sa Pilipinas o ito ay sa abroad. Dito kasi sa Pilipinas, ang mga crew ng fastfood ay daily wage earner. So, sila mayroong holiday pay kung sila ay magta-trabaho during a holiday. Kung ang holiday ay bumabagsak sa Sunday, it depends kung Sunday ang rest day nila. Kasi, kung rest day nila ay Sunday, tapos, holiday din, pero siya ay nag-report for work, may holiday pay iyong at rest day pay.
Pero ang mga professional (katulad ng mga teacher) ay usually monthly paid employees. Ang holiday pay ay kasama na sa kanilang monthly pay rate). Ask a lawyer and show the lawyer your contract of employment para maliwanag.
